Recent Engineering Decisions in Industry

Edited by Yuan Zhi Wang





This book is currently unavailable. Enquire to check if we can source a used copy


| book description |

Collection of selected, peer reviewed papers from the 2nd International Conference on Materials Science and Mechanical Engineering (ICMSME 2014), September 1-2, 2014, Hong Kong, China. The 49 papers are grouped as follows: Chapter 1: Applied Materials Science and Related Industrial Technologies, Chapter 2: Mechanical Engineering, Chapter 3: Applied and Computational Mechanics, Chapter 4: Materials and Technologies in Construction, Chapter 5: Control, Communication and Electronics, Chapter 6: Measurements, Chapter 7: Biomedical Engineering, Chapter 8: Computational Mathematics and Mathematical Modeling
